Quality control and safety
Ensuring product quality and safety is paramount in the packaging industry. AI is transforming quality control processes by automating inspections and detecting defects with unprecedented accuracy.
Machine vision systems equipped with AI algorithms can quickly identify issues such as packaging defects, labelling errors, or contamination. This reduces the risk of faulty products reaching consumers, safeguards brand reputation, and minimises costly recalls.
Supply chain optimisation
AI’s impact on packaging extends beyond the design and production stages. It is revolutionising supply chain management by optimising inventory levels, predicting demand, and improving logistics.
AI algorithms can analyse historical data, market trends, and external factors to make accurate demand forecasts, helping companies streamline their packaging operations. This leads to reduced costs, minimised waste, and improved overall efficiency throughout the supply chain.
